Output 75e2c7148b4c3488997d5ef8f3ce129cc24447fdb3dee444026c6cf64b51ee54:8

value
58007589
script pubkey
OP_0 OP_PUSHBYTES_20 25d4baaa7d988b595cbe69c0d6d81bc2a54df733
address
bc1qyh2t42nanz94jh97d8qddkqmc2j5maenpu7kl9
transaction
75e2c7148b4c3488997d5ef8f3ce129cc24447fdb3dee444026c6cf64b51ee54
spent
true